Body

Origins and Family

Sung Han-kuk was born in South Korea[2]. He was born on +1963-11-19T00:00:00Z[3]. Korean was his native language[11].

Career and Affiliations

Recorded occupations include badminton player[4], badminton coach[5], and non-fiction writer[6].

Works and Contributions

Notable works include Badminton[12] and The relationship between coach and athlete: Relationship, self-determination, motivation and emotion of badminton players[13].

Recognition

Sung Han-kuk received the national champion[14].

Personal Life

Among Sung Han-kuk's spouses was Kim Yun-ja[8]. A child of him was Sung Ji-hyun[9].
